On the statistical side, consumer inflation fell to a 13-month low of 6,3% year-on-year in May 2023, mainly due to lower increases in food and fuel costs. On the downside, however, the number of civil summonses issued for debt increased by 0,3% in the three months ended April 2023 compared with the three months ended April 2022. This could indicate that some consumers struggle to keep up with their credit commitments.
